What type of noun is the word “July” in the following sentence?

Every July he goes on vacation to Bermuda.

A.
simple noun

B.
compound noun

C.
proper noun


Respuesta :

PunIntended
PunIntended PunIntended
  • 04-08-2018

The answer is (C).

All proper nouns begin with a capital letter (e.g. Annie, Florida, American, etc)

Since July is capitalized, it is a proper noun.
